what do i do when my business partner betrays me?
Understanding Betrayal and Moving Forward
When your business partner betrays you, it can be a challenging and painful experience. Betrayal can take many forms, including dishonesty, manipulation, or abuse of trust. In such situations, it's essential to take a step back, assess the situation, and prioritize your emotional well-being. Take time to process your feelings and consider seeking support from a trusted friend, family member, or mental health professional.
Principles for Dealing with Betrayal
From a biblical perspective, dealing with betrayal requires a combination of wisdom, courage, and compassion. As the Bible reminds us, God is sovereign and in control, even when we face difficult circumstances (Psalm 115:3). We can trust in His goodness and faithfulness, even when our business partner has failed us. When dealing with betrayal, it's crucial to focus on what is clear and take action accordingly. If the betrayal has led to a breach of trust, it may be necessary to re-evaluate the business partnership and consider seeking outside help to resolve the issue. In some cases, it may be necessary to end the business relationship altogether.
Seeking Redemption and Moving Forward
In the midst of betrayal, it's easy to feel overwhelmed and unsure of how to move forward. However, as the Bible reminds us, God can bring good out of difficult situations (Romans 8:28). When facing betrayal, it's essential to seek redemption and restoration. This may involve seeking forgiveness, both from God and from your business partner. It may also involve taking steps to prevent similar situations from arising in the future. By prioritizing integrity, transparency, and accountability, you can build trust and credibility with your business partner and others. Ultimately, dealing with betrayal requires a commitment to spiritual growth, self-reflection, and a willingness to seek guidance and support from trusted sources. By doing so, you can navigate challenging situations with wisdom, courage, and compassion.
